The Ninth Configuration

"The Ninth Configuration" centers on Colonel Vincent Kane, a military psychiatrist overseeing an army mental hospital set within a remote castle. Among his patients is Captain Billy Cutshaw, a tormented astronaut grappling with a profound existential crisis. Despite Kane's own tenuous sanity, he engages Cutshaw in deep conversations about the intersections of science and faith, which profoundly shape their understanding of life and reality.

At its core, the film explores themes of faith, sanity, and the human search for meaning amid chaos. It challenges the boundaries between sanity and madness, questioning how individuals cope with trauma and doubt. The dialogues between Kane and Cutshaw serve as a philosophical battleground where reason confronts belief, highlighting the complexity of human psychology and spirituality. Furthermore, the setting—a castle turned asylum—symbolizes isolation and the fortress-like barriers people erect around their minds to protect or imprison themselves.

Upon release, "The Ninth Configuration" garnered critical acclaim for its thought-provoking narrative and compelling performances, quickly earning a cult classic status among fans of psychological drama and philosophical cinema. Its nuanced treatment of mental health and spirituality influenced subsequent films and discussions within pop culture, prompting deeper conversations about the portrayal of mental illness and the role of faith in contemporary storytelling.
